A good friend just received a pair of the 704s a couple weeks ago and received a great buying experience with Mike at Suncoast.
I had the pleasure of hearing these in the first few hours of play day 1 and while they will benefit from thorough break-in, their incredible
potential and abilities as a great speaker were immediately obvious. The killer price further seals the deal that this is one of the great
speaker performers out there at a bargain price.
I heard the top F-series Fyne speakers in Munich 2019 and was incredibly pleased and impressed with them. The 704 also has an equally beautiful
cabinet in the Walnut finish, great build quality, the bottom plinth for egress of bass from the bottom-ported enclosure (all of that strikes me as a brilliant
design choice by Fyne) but adds the 2nd front-firing driver for even better bass resolution and extent.
704 sound, imaging, etc...: amazing and worth MANY times its price. Good top-line cables bring out even more and break-in is something I'm eagerly

Fyne 704’s
Hi Shane - the 704’s are equally as good or better than speakers costing the same. They are DESIGNED for LARGE rooms. They are beasts. Big sound, big bass, but smoooooooooth and dynamic. I wouldn’t play them in anything less than 20 x 25 (on average). They can really fill a room and aren’t fussy with treatments. Oh, and the Fyne’s love vinyl.
